Job Summary:

    The Enhanced Care Management (ECM) Clinician is responsible for member coordination, improving health outcomes, enhancing satisfaction, and reducing unnecessary healthcare utilization. ECM is a comprehensive, patient-centered approach to healthcare that aims to improve outcomes for high-need populations.  This involves the coordination of medical, behavioral, and social services to address the full range of member needs, focusing on those with complex and chronic conditions. 

    ECM programs are designed to optimize care delivery, reduce unnecessary hospitalizations, and improve the overall quality of life for members. The intention of our services is to help people who have not been able to get the needed help in terms of Housing, Mental Health, Substance Abuse treatment, and linkages to community resources to help minimize recidivism.

    The role of the ECM Clinical Case Manager provides integrated clinical and case management services to justice-involved individuals enrolled in Enhanced Care Management (ECM), with a primary focus on in-custody engagement within Orange County jail facilities and post-release community reintegration. This role delivers in-person assessments, pre-release planning, and clinical coordination inside the three Orange County jail facilities, while maintaining continuity of care through post-release case management, clinical touchpoints, and linkage to services in the community.

    The Clinical Case Manager operates as part of a multidisciplinary Orange County care team, supporting individuals with complex medical, behavioral health, substance use, and social needs. The goal is to improve health outcomes, reduce recidivism, and support successful transitions to stable housing, treatment, and long-term community integration.

    This position requires the ability to work effectively in secure custodial environments and field-based settings across Orange County, while adhering to all facility regulations and maintaining a high level of clinical and professional standards

     

    Essential Duties:

     

  • Interview and conduct clinical assessments of member’s needs, including medical, behavioral, and social factors.
  • Develop, implement, and monitor personalized care plans in collaboration with members, their families, healthcare providers, and community resources.
  • Conduct outreach to identify and engage eligible in ECM services, using multiple strategies and modalities for engagement.
  • Operate as part of the member’s multi-disciplinary care team.
  • Facilitate regular team meetings to review patient cases, address challenges, and share successes.
  • Travel locally to deliver services to members in the community where they live, work, or frequent.
  • Document services in the agency’s Electronic Health Record within 72 hours of each service and in compliance with agency policy, as well as contractual, state, and federal regulations.
  • Provide accurate daily and monthly documentation and case notes as per funding source guidelines.
  • Attend workshops, meetings, and trainings as requested by supervisor.
  • Provide in-person pre-release case management services within Orange County jail facilities, including conducting assessments, initiating care plans, and engaging members before release.
  • Complete and maintain clearance for county jail access, including passing all required background checks and complying with facility-specific rules and regulations at all times.
  • Adhere to all county jail visiting policies, procedures, and security protocols, demonstrating professionalism and compliance in a custodial setting.
